快速处理 MySQL 重复数据
转载 2020-06-03 10:21:41
594阅读
1点赞
java中处理数据的方法在c和c++中,大数据往往会因为超过该类型的最大长度而导致溢出等问题,解决起来也比较麻烦(反正它们给的解决办法我是看不懂。。。。)java为了解决该问题,有两个类BigInteger和BigDecimal 分别表示大整数类和大浮点数类,可以存储无限大的数,只要计算机内存足够大。前两天在用到BigInteger的时候发现他的用法和int这些普通类型的用法不太一样,顺便了解了
处理实现mysql数据库备份为了实现数据库每日自动化备份,我们可以结合windows系统的任务计划,定时运行我们的bat文件,实现每日自动备份。任务计划也可以用批处理实现,但是本文主要不是讲这个,而且任务计划只要我们手动点一点就行了实现:1.首先我们需要新建一个配置文件,我的config.ini,具体内容如下[FILE_PATH] mysql_bin=mysql安装路径\bin\ backup_
第5章 处理响应数据5.1 SpringMVC 输出模型数据概述5.1.1提供了以下几种途径输出模型数据ModelAndView: 处理方法返回值类型为 ModelAndView 时, 方法体即可通过该对象添加模型数据Map 及 Model: 入参为 org.springframework.ui.Model、org.springframework.ui.ModelMap 或 java.u...
原创 2021-08-18 10:08:52
43阅读
第5章 处理响应数据5.1 SpringMVC 输出模型数据概述5.1.1提供了以下几种途径输出模型数据ModelAndView: 处理方法返回值类型为 ModelAndView 时, 方法体即可通过该对象添加模型数据Map 及 Model: 入参为 org.springframework.ui.Model、org.springframework.ui.ModelMap 或 java.u...
原创 2022-03-04 10:17:11
80阅读
正好最近在帮客户从达梦数据库迁移到 MySQL。我也来简单说说重复数据处理。 存放在数据库中的数据分为三种:1. 一种是经过严格意义过滤出来的数据。比如程序端过滤数据源、数据库端在表字段上设置 check 标记过滤数据源、设置触发器过滤、调用存储过程过滤等等;2. 另一种是原始的没有经过任何处理
转载 2020-02-11 16:34:00
81阅读
2评论
文章目录加速处理数据的思路动机最开始的方法1. 概述2. 遇到的问题3. 速度慢的根本原因优化后的方法1. 概述2. 具体方法(具体代码看下一章)方法一:批量查询数据,减少调用数据库的次数方法二:建立数据库索引并定时重建索引方法三:查询数据时指定列,不要全部查询所有列方法四:多进程运行python程序方法五:用DataX工具 将结果存入数据库推荐方法/工具一、multiprocessing:多
注意代码中LONGITUDE、LATITUDE、SPEED、DIRECT等属于博主做交通数据处理时的残留模板。如要自定义使用替换为使用场景下的对应词句即可import pandas as pd import numpy as np import matplotlib.pyplot as pit # %matplotlib inline import csv import codecs impor
在互联网行业中,无论你是开发、运营、数据还是算法,你或多或少都离不开数据数据处理是一项基本且必要的技能。在数据处理中,有许多操作使用常规方法可以做,但繁琐且代码臃肿。本文我将介绍 8 种数据处理的技巧,这些技巧几乎涵盖了数据科学所需要的操作。1、PivotPivot 将创建一个"透视表",该方法将数据中的现有列作为新表的元素(索引、列和值)进行重组,类似 Excel 中的透视表。示意图代码如下所
# 用批处理快速启动 MySQL 的指南 在这篇文章中,我们将学习如何通过批处理(Batch)文件来快速启动 MySQL 数据库。批处理文件是一种包含一系列命令的文本文件,可以在 Windows 系统中自动执行这些命令。通过本指南,你将能够创建一个批处理文件,并在需要时快速启动 MySQL。 ## 整体流程 首先,让我们了解一下实现这个任务的整体流程。以下是步骤的概览: | 步骤编号 |
正好最近在帮客户从达梦数据库迁移到 MySQL。我也来简单说说重复数据处理。存放在数据库中的数据分为三种:1. 一种是经过严格意义过滤出来的数据。比如程序端过滤数据源、数据库端在表字段上设置 check 标记过滤数据源、设置触发器过滤、调用存储过程过滤等等;2. 另一种是原始的没有经过任何处理数据。比如程序端代码异常导致产生非正常的想要的数据数据库端没有设置任何过滤规则的数据保留等等。这样会
原创 2021-01-25 08:40:22
242阅读
作者:杨涛涛正好最近在帮客户从达梦数据库迁移到 MySQL。我也来简单说说重复数何过滤规则的数据保...
原创 2022-12-20 15:09:35
148阅读
第4章 处理请求数据4.1 请求处理方法签名Spring MVC 通过分析处理方法的签名,HTTP请求信息绑定到处理方法的相应人参中。Spring MVC 对控制器处理方法签名的限制是很宽松的,几乎可以按喜欢的任何方式对方法进行签名。必要时可以对方法及方法入参标注相应的注解( @PathVariable 、@RequestParam、@RequestHeader 等)、Spring M...
原创 2021-08-18 10:08:54
102阅读
第4章 处理请求数据4.1 请求处理方法签名Spring MVC 通过分析处理方法的签名,HTTP请求信息绑定到处理方法的相应人参中。Spring MVC 对控制器处理方法签名的限制是很宽松的,几乎可以按喜欢的任何方式对方法进行签名。必要时可以对方法及方法入参标注相应的注解( @PathVariable 、@RequestParam、@RequestHeader 等)、Spring M...
原创 2022-03-04 10:17:25
87阅读
处理数据时,Apache Spark常被用于提高数据处理的速度和效率。然而,在使用过程中也可能遇到不少问题,特别是在大规模数据处理时。本文将讨论如何解决“Spark快速数据处理”中的具体问题,并提出有效的解决方案和优化建议。 ## 问题背景 在某电商平台运行的数据分析过程中,团队发现数据处理速度逐渐变慢,影响了实时分析的结果。这直接导致了用户体验的下降,进而影响了转化率。 - 时间线事
原创 7月前
54阅读
# MySQL快速模拟数据教程 ## 简介 在开发过程中,经常需要对数据库进行测试,但是手动插入数据往往效率低下。因此,我们可以使用脚本来快速模拟数据。本文将教你如何使用MySQL快速模拟数据。 ## 整体流程 下面是整个过程的流程图: ```mermaid erDiagram Developer --* Database: 创建数据库 Developer --> Table
原创 2024-01-30 10:52:49
166阅读
# MySQL 快速导入数据教程 ## 引言 在开发过程中,我们经常需要将数据导入到MySQL数据库中。如果数据量较大,传统的逐条插入数据的方式效率较低。本文将教你如何使用MySQL快速导入数据方法,提高导入效率。 ## 流程图 ```mermaid flowchart TD A[准备数据文件] --> B[创建数据库表] B --> C[导入数据] ``` ## 步骤
原创 2023-11-16 18:54:28
57阅读
# MySQL 快速插入数据的科普 在数据驱动的时代,数据库的性能常常是应用程序成功的关键因素之一。尤其是在需要处理大量数据的情况下,快速插入数据变得尤为重要。本文将探讨在 MySQL 中如何有效地快速插入数据,代码示例及相关流程图。 ## 数据插入的基本方法 首先,MySQL 提供了多种插入数据的方法。常用的方法有: 1. **单条插入**:适合数据量小的场景。 2. **批量插入**:
原创 2024-10-12 04:04:51
39阅读
MySQL 5.1 中,在复制方面的改进就是引进了新的复制技术:基于行的复制。MYSQL复制的几种模式MySQL 5.1 中,在复制方面的改进就是引进了新的复制技术:基于行的复制。简言之,这种新技术就是关注表中发生变化的记录,而非以前的照抄 binlog 模式。从 MySQL 5.1.12 开始,可以用以下三种模式来实现:-- 基于SQL语句的复制(statement-based replicat
# MySQL快速插入数据 MySQL是一个常用的关系型数据库管理系统,广泛应用于各种Web应用和大型企业级系统。在实际应用中,我们经常需要向MySQL数据库中插入大量数据。本文将介绍几种快速插入数据的方法,以提高数据插入的效率。 ## 1. 批量插入数据 MySQL提供了`INSERT INTO`语句来插入数据,但是每次插入一条记录会导致频繁的网络通信和磁盘IO,影响插入的效率。为了提高插
原创 2023-10-11 12:35:05
166阅读
  • 1
  • 2
  • 3
  • 4
  • 5